Max Kellermann 797c1f11bb php: fix linker errors by setting ac_cv_func_dlopen=no
The autoconf variable `ac_cv_func_dlopen` controls whether `dlopen()`
is available without linking `libdl.so`.  But that doesn't work:

 tmp-glibc/work/aarch64-oe-linux/php/7.2.10-r0/recipe-sysroot-native/usr/bin/aarch64-oe-linux/../../libexec/aarch64-oe-linux/gcc/aarch64-oe-linux/8.2.0/ld: ext/sqlite3/libsqlite/sqlite3.o: undefined reference to symbol 'dlsym@@GLIBC_2.17'
 tmp-glibc/work/aarch64-oe-linux/php/7.2.10-r0/recipe-sysroot-native/usr/bin/aarch64-oe-linux/../../libexec/aarch64-oe-linux/gcc/aarch64-oe-linux/8.2.0/ld: tmp-glibc/work/aarch64-oe-linux/php/7.2.10-r0/recipe-sysroot/lib/libdl.so.2: error adding symbols: DSO missing from command line

Leave `ac_cv_lib_dl_dlopen=yes`, because that's the one which controls
whether `-ldl` is needed.

Max Kellermann eaf93e8c67 php: add "--without-sqlite3 --without-pdo-sqlite"
Removing "sqlite3" from `PACKAGECONFIG` doesn't actually disable
SQLite, because those options default to "yes".  It just switches from
the system SQLite to PHP's internal SQLite copy.

Anuj Mittal 0d052a48c9 php: add opcache extension to PACKAGECONFIG
OPcache improves PHP performance by storing precompiled script bytecode
in shared memory, thereby removing the need for PHP to load and parse
scripts on each request [1].

Add an option to enable opcache in php. AC_CHECK_FUNC isn't suitable for a
cross-compile environment, so pass the configure options instead to force
dlopen detection that is necessary to have extension support enabled.

On a standard phpbench test, I see a performance improvement of > 40%.

[1] http://php.net/manual/en/book.opcache.php
